Asset Tagging Solutions for Kenyan Businesses
Asset tagging solutions are becoming increasingly popular in Kenya as businesses recognize the importance of effectively managing their assets. These solutions involve implementing unique tags to physical assets such as computers, equipment, and furniture. This allows businesses to accurately record the location, condition, and value of their assets.
The benefits of asset tagging for Kenyan businesses are numerous. It can boost control by deterring theft and vandalism. By understanding the whereabouts of their assets at any given time, businesses can utilize their resources more strategically. Asset tagging also simplifies maintenance processes by providing a comprehensive record of asset information.
Moreover, it can help reduce costs by streamlining loss. Kenyan businesses that implement asset tagging solutions are well-positioned to gain a competitive edge in the market.
Durable Anodized Aluminium Tags: Ideal for Kenyan Assets
These are a strong solution for labeling your assets in Kenya. Anodizing creates a durable layer on the aluminium, providing resistance against corrosion. This makes them perfect for harsh conditions often experienced in Kenya.
With their legible surface, you can simply show vital information like identification numbers.

Implementing Effective Fixed Asset Tagging Methods in Kenya
Effective fixed asset tagging strategies are crucial for any organization operating in Kenya. They guarantee accurate tracking of assets, which is essential for financial reporting, minimizing theft and loss, and optimizing maintenance schedules. A well-implemented tagging system can significantly improve the efficiency and accountability of asset management within Kenyan businesses.
To implement an effective fixed asset tagging system, organizations should consider several factors. These encompass identifying the right type of tags, developing a clear tagging policy, and confirming proper tag attachment.
Furthermore, organizations should instruct their staff on the importance of fixed asset tagging and follow the established guidelines to optimize the effectiveness of the system.
